Orlando-Kissimmee-Sanford vs Rapid City

Fair Market Rent Comparison — HUD 2025 Data

Quick Answer

Rapid City is 54% cheaper for renters. A 2-bedroom rents for $835/mo vs $1,282/mo in Orlando-Kissimmee-Sanford — saving $5,364/year.

Rent by Unit Size

Unit SizeOrlando-Kissimmee-SanfordRapid CityDifference
Studio$796$574$222
1 Bedroom$1,005$702$303
2 Bedrooms$1,282$835$447
3 Bedrooms$1,497$1,106$391
4 Bedrooms$1,680$1,277$403
Median Income$73,282$44,904$28,378
